Honey & Aloe Vera Mask: Your Skin’s Natural Glow Boost
This first overnight treatment is both super simple and an absolute classic. Honey and aloe vera? Yes, please. This combo is like the PB&J of skincare. Both ingredients are packed with moisturizing and healing benefits, plus they’re probably already chilling in your kitchen.
Why we heart this:
– Honey: It’s full of antioxidants and works as a natural humectant, pulling moisture into your skin. Plus, it helps fight acne by killing bacteria like… a true queen. 🍯
– Aloe Vera: Aloe is like that friend who’s always super chill (you know the one). It can soothe redness, hydrate, and heal, especially after a day sweating it out under layers of foundation.
Mix about 1 tablespoon of honey with 1 tablespoon of aloe vera gel. Apply it all over your face in thin layers before bedtime, and let the magic happen overnight. You’ll wake up with skin so smooth you’ll want to take selfies before even brushing your teeth.

DIY Avocado & Vitamin E Treatment: Time to Glow Up!
You know how avocado toast is like, the GOAT of breakfasts? Well, avocados are also the GOAT of skincare. One word: hydration. Your skin craves it — especially after a day covered in makeup. Pair it with Vitamin E, and you’ve got a nighttime treatment that’s next level.
Here’s the tea on why this works so well:
– Avocados: They are loaded up with healthy fats, and they basically drench your skin in moisture. It’s like giving your skin a fancy spa day while you’re over there catching some Z’s.
– Vitamin E: OK, so this one’s kinda famous for its anti-aging properties. It’s legit a powerful antioxidant that helps protect your skin and reduce any redness.
Here’s what you do: Mash up half an avocado in a bowl, then pierce a Vitamin E capsule and squeeze a few drops of the oil in. Mix that up and apply it like a smooth, green paste all over your face. Oatmeal & Yogurt Mask: Soothing Goodness
Okay, if your skin’s been giving off some “I’m irritated” vibes, then this oatmeal treatment is exactly what you need. Oats aren’t just good for your morning breakfast—they’re key to calming redness and giving your skin some TLC. Add yogurt and get ready for that smooth, I’ll-literally-glow-all-day glow.
Here’s what they do:
– Oatmeal: Oats help soothe inflammation, and they’re gentle on your skin. Like, imagine the chillest possible friend, and yeah, that’s oats in this scenario.
– Yogurt: It has lactic acid, which gently exfoliates dead skin cells overnight for those smooth baby-feels.
All you’ve gotta do is mix 2 tablespoons of plain yogurt with 1 tablespoon of finely ground oatmeal. Apply a nice, even layer and get ready for some major calm-facial-vibes. You can leave it on as you sleep or wash it off after 15 minutes if overnight masks are not your thing.
Coconut Oil & Turmeric Mask: Glow Like a Goddess
Okay, this mask is going to make you feel so extra in the best way possible. Coconut oil is straight-up legendary in the skincare community, and turmeric does things to your face that’ll make your filter game jealous 🧡. It’s kinda like bringing that spa energy into your own bathroom.
Here’s why this is essential:
– Coconut Oil: Have you heard? Coconut oil is basically a moisture bomb. It hydrates and leaves your skin clear and glowy.
– Turmeric: Turmeric has been that girl. It’s anti-inflammatory and gets rid of any dullness while brightening your complexion. (Pro tip: it’s also really good for acne scars!)
All you need is 1 tablespoon of coconut oil and a pinch (and I mean tiny) of turmeric powder. Mix it up, apply evenly to your face (avoiding clothes because turmeric can stain!), and sleep your way to glowy goodness.
